Are you raising teenage children? Everyday life feels overwhelming for all families and, when a teenager is in the picture, the stress can be even higher. What works for one child might not work for another, and what worked when that child was 15 won’t necessarily work at 16. As a parent or caregiver, do you ever need help getting through sticky situations? Do you feel cornered or realize that your methods are not working? Do you want to try something different? The Tool Box teaches positive, understandable, and practical skills and strategies for you and your teen, including how to: • Communicate effectively and clearly • Identify core issues • Prioritize needs and wants • Brainstorm • Navigate conflict • Learn the wonders of true compromise This time-tested, solution-focused approach—used by many therapists and counselors to help parents, mentors, and teachers navigate new territories—will help you raise healthy and content teenagers; build successful, strong, and positive relationships with them; and prepare them for the rest of their lives.
